Toyota announces Special Edition Corolla Hatchback
Toyota has announced a limited production 2021 Corolla Hatchback Special Edition. The automaker plans to produce just 1,500 units of the special vehicle, dressed in new Supersonic Red paint and carrying a unique body modification kit. The body kit adds a sporty front splitter, side skirts, black rear roof spoiler, a rear bumper garnish and a unique Special Edition badge. Special edition 18-inch black-painted alloy wheels are also part of the package.
As on the 2020 versions, all 2021 Corolla Hatchback models will include Toyota Safety Sense 2.0 as standard equipment. This suite of driver-assist technologies includes Toyota's pre-collision system with daytime/low-light vehicle and pedestrian detection, plus daytime bicyclist detection, lane departure alert with steering assist, automatic high beams, and road sign assistance. Additionally, models equipped with continuously variable transmissions include full-speed range dynamic radar cruise control and lane tracing assist.
Performance is also part of the package. Like all Corolla hatchbacks, the Special Edition includes a multi-link rear suspension and a 168-horsepower 2.0-liter engine, paired with the continuously variable transmission.
Toyota did not release pricing information on the new model, but noted that the Corolla Hatchback Special Edition will be available through area dealers in late summer.
